Maximize Vertical Space with Wall-Mounted Solutions
Utilize wall-mounted shelves, pegboards, and magnetic spice racks to free up counter and cabinet space. Floating shelves keep essentials within reach while adding a modern, minimalist look. Pegboards offer customizable storage for tools and utensils, transforming bare walls into functional zones.
Hidden Compartments in Everyday Fixtures
Integrate storage into everyday elements—install pull-out baskets in island edges, recessed cutouts in countertops for small appliances, and under-sink niches with deep trays. These subtle additions maintain a clean aesthetic while maximizing hidden storage in high-traffic areas.
Multi-Functional Furniture for Compact Kitchens
Adopt foldable or convertible furniture like retractable trivets doubling as tray stations, or a kitchen island with built-in foldable seating and hidden storage compartments. These pieces serve dual roles, saving space and enhancing usability without clutter.
Transparent Containers and Labeling for Visibility
Use clear acrylic or glass containers to store dry goods like grains, snacks, and baking supplies. Labeling with simple, elegant tags preserves order and enables quick access, making organization both practical and visually appealing in cabinet-free setups.
